Nylanderia pygmaea

Insecta - Hymenoptera - Formicidae

Taxonomy
Prenolepis pygmaea was named by Mayr (1868). Its type specimen is B 5080, an exoskeleton, and it is an inclusion in amber.

It was recombined as Paratrechina pygmaea by Dlussky and Rasnitsyn (2009); it was recombined as Nylanderia pygmaea by LaPolla and Dlussky (2010).
